influxDB

文章目录

    • 版本
    • 2.0 数据结构
      • Organization 组织
      • Bucket 存储桶
        • Measurement
          • tag
          • field
          • timestamp
      • retention policy (RP) 保留策略
      • Point 一条数据
      • Series 一组数据
    • 写入
      • gzip压缩
    • 查询
      • Flux
      • InfluxQL

  • 官网
    https://docs.influxdata.com/
  • v1.8 中文翻译文档
    https://influxdb-v1-docs-cn.cnosdb.com/

版本

开源版(OSS)
企业版(Enterprise)
云版(Cloud)

2.0 数据结构

InfluxDB 数据模型将时间序列数据 存储到存储桶和测量中

Organization 组织

Organization是一组用户的工作空间。
所有仪表板、任务、Bucket和user 都属于一个组织

Bucket 存储桶

InfluxDB 数据都存储在存储桶中。

Bucket 结合了 database 和 retention period 的概念

用户(user)、保留策略(retention policy)、连续查询(continuous query)和时序数据的逻辑容器。

Measurement

时间序列数据的逻辑分组

tag

存储 不经常更改的键值对

field

存储 随时间变化的值的键值对

timestamp

存储 与数据关联的时间戳

retention policy (RP) 保留策略

Point 一条数据

influxDB_第1张图片

Series 一组数据

Measurement、tage相同的一组数据

写入

最佳实践:( 时间/毫秒,数据条数,当其中一个先达到时批量插入)

gzip压缩

查询

Flux

函数式脚本语言

InfluxQL

类似 SQL 的查询语言

你可能感兴趣的:(DB,大数据,influx)